A easy health tracker would possibly maintain the important thing to revolutionizing maternal well being care. Scientists at Scripps Analysis have discovered preliminary proof suggesting that frequent wearable gadgets such because the Apple Watch, Garmin and Fitbit might remotely monitor pregnancy-related well being adjustments by monitoring physiological patterns—like coronary heart fee—that correlate with hormonal fluctuations.
“Wearable devices offer a unique opportunity to develop innovative solutions that address the high number of adverse pregnancy outcomes in the U.S.,” says co-senior creator Giorgio Quer, the director of synthetic intelligence and assistant professor of Digital Medication at Scripps Analysis.
“Our results show that signals collected via wearable sensors follow the expected changes in hormone levels and can detect unique patterns specific to live-birth pregnancies, potentially allowing the monitoring of maternal health throughout the pregnancy and postpartum.”
The findings, launched in eBioMedicine, come at a vital time for maternal well being within the U.S. Greater than 2 million ladies of childbearing age reside in maternal care deserts, or areas with severely restricted entry to obstetric care. The paper is titled “Association between wearable sensor signals and expected hormonal changes in pregnancy.”
Being pregnant issues, together with miscarriage and preterm beginning, proceed to pose vital dangers to maternal and baby well being, demanding simpler methods to observe and deal with these outcomes.
Aligning coronary heart charges and hormones
To collect the information, the staff used PowerMom, a bilingual digital analysis platform, which allowed contributors to voluntarily report real-world knowledge from their private wearable gadgets after offering knowledgeable consent—capturing priceless info past the standard prenatal clinic visits.
The researchers enrolled over 5,600 contributors who explicitly agreed to share their knowledge and chosen 108 people who had consented to offer knowledge from three months earlier than their being pregnant via six months after supply.
Utilizing refined statistical strategies to determine population-level patterns, the staff might account for particular person variations and machine variations.
From these knowledge, the scientists had been capable of determine physiological patterns that aligned with the fluctuation of key being pregnant hormones akin to estrogen, progesterone and human chorionic gonadotropin (hCG). The fluctuations of those hormones are crucial to wholesome being pregnant outcomes and supply perception into the being pregnant’s development.
The center fee knowledge had been significantly compelling. Throughout early being pregnant, researchers discovered that the person’s coronary heart fee initially decreased round weeks 5 to 9, then steadily elevated till about eight or 9 weeks earlier than supply, reaching peaks as much as 9.4 beats per minute above pre-pregnancy ranges.
After beginning, the center fee dropped beneath baseline ranges earlier than stabilizing round six months postpartum. The researchers additionally tracked sleep and exercise patterns all through being pregnant.
To validate this correlation, the staff in contrast wearable sensor patterns with revealed hormone-level knowledge from earlier being pregnant research, creating detailed fashions that predicted coronary heart fee adjustments based mostly on anticipated hormonal fluctuations all through being pregnant.
Whereas these findings are nonetheless early, they show that wearables might doubtlessly improve prenatal care, significantly for ladies residing in maternal care deserts.
“Hormones play a key role in pregnancy outcomes,” explains co-senior creator Tolúwalàṣẹ Àjàyí, co-senior creator and principal investigator of PowerMom.
“Discovering the association between heart rate and hormone changes could unlock new ways to predict the beginning of pregnancy or identify signs of adverse outcomes such as gestational diabetes or preeclampsia.”
In an exploratory evaluation of a small variety of circumstances, pregnancies ending in hostile outcomes like miscarriage or stillbirth confirmed totally different coronary heart fee patterns in comparison with wholesome pregnancies, although extra analysis with bigger pattern sizes is required to validate these observations.
The way forward for well being monitoring
This analysis represents a major step towards making being pregnant monitoring extra accessible via expertise that many people already personal and use. By remodeling client gadgets into medical monitoring instruments, the method might assist bridge well being care gaps and supply steady oversight for high-risk pregnancies.
The digital method builds on rising proof that wearable gadgets can detect significant well being adjustments a lot earlier. Earlier work has proven their position in figuring out COVID-19 infections and different well being situations via physiological sample recognition.
The researchers plan to broaden their evaluation with a give attention to understanding how patterns might differ throughout totally different demographic teams, geographic areas and socioeconomic backgrounds. They hope to finally develop fashions that might determine birthing people who would possibly profit from further monitoring or assist.
“We want to understand if these patterns are consistent across subgroups based on age and access to care,” says first creator and UC San Diego graduate pupil, Giulia Milan, who performed this examine in collaboration with Scripps Analysis. “Our goal is to determine whether this approach could eventually contribute to more personalized pregnancy care.”
Future research might want to examine whether or not physiological adjustments captured by wearables might doubtlessly assist medical decision-making and affected person care. The staff additionally plans to gather each wearable knowledge and blood samples from the identical contributors to immediately validate the hormone-heart fee associations noticed on this preliminary evaluation.
